Travis Scott x Air Jordan 1 Sneaker Gets A “Hello Kitty” Colourway

The upcoming release of the Hello Kitty adidas Samba has us all excited to embrace all things cute and stylish once more. From the teasers we have seen, this collaboration between the beloved Sanrio character and adidas promises to bring a fresh and playful twist to the classic Samba silhouette. Yet, it’s impossible to dismiss that a partnership with Nike previously birthed the Air Presto Hello Kitty sneaker. Although we commend this collaboration, we couldn’t help but ponder how striking it might have been if, instead of teaming up with Nike for the vibrant Air Presto Hello Kitty sneaker, the brand had turned to Nike’s sub-label, the Air Jordan 1, for their foundational design.  

Well, thanks to the creative mind of Dariyn Enriquez of @dope_don_designs, our curious thoughts no longer need to linger. In his genius, Enriquez has birthed a prototype portraying what an Air Jordan Low meshed with Hello Kitty would look like, cleverly drawing inspiration from the aesthetics of another renowned sneaker, the Travis Scott x Jordan 1.

In his rendition of the famed footwear, the inventive concept artist has beautifully washed the Travis Scott x Air Jordan 1 in calming hues of pink and plum, giving birth to a chic Hello Kitty sneaker. It’s so striking that even the gentlemen amongst us might want to flaunt a pair. 

The trainers are bathed in a light pink base, juxtaposed with darker pink accents on the eye stays and heel. The mudguard flaunts a captivating plum shade, while Travis Scott’s iconic reverse swoosh stands out in mineral white. Suitably, the overlays and Swoosh are bordered with jet black, capturing Hello Kitty’s body outline.

We’re so accustomed to seeing Hello Kitty’s charming face plastered on everything from stationary to apparel; it’s somewhat peculiar not to find her face emblazoned across the mock-up sneaker design. Yet, it’s a refreshing break from tradition. While her lovely face is undeniably cute, the subtlety of the design is appreciated. It broadens the appeal to a larger audience than if her likeness had just been strewn all over the shoes.  

Still, the concept sneaker subtly hints at her trademark details. The cute little bow ordinarily gracing her hair is cleverly located on the mudguard, while the alternate flower, occasionally replacing the bow, is fashionably emblazoned on the heel. These small elements subtly distil the essence of Hello Kitty without overwhelming the design. It’s an ingenious way of introducing her legendary elements, maintaining style and elegance without catering exclusively to a particular fan base. This unique fusion of subtlety and style is sure to appeal to both Hello Kitty lovers and anyone who values slick design.  

Completing this stylish sneaker concept is a sail midsole, a black outsole and pretty pink laces that beautifully unify the design.  All in all, this Hello Kitty sneaker concept perfectly combines the princess of cuteness and Nike’s classic Dunk Low silhouette. Again, we love the subtlety of the design, but we appreciate that there are details that link this sneaker to Hello Kitty.
